| contents | This dataset comprises multiproxy biogeochemical (elemental and isotope geochemistry, visible-near infrared spectroscopy, computed tomography, magnetic susceptibility) data and diatom assemblage data for sediment sequences retrieved from lakes Santa Maria del Oro (Nayarit, Mexico) and Teremendo (Michoacán, Mexico) in April 2022. The data cover a time period from 2022 to around 1650 and were used to explore connections between lake carbon cycling and related ecosystem processes under natural and anthropogenic environmental change over the past four centuries. |
